# HG changeset patch # User Yuya Nishihara # Date 1428064599 -32400 # Node ID d80819f67d5961a91da723e29677c78f8992b789 # Parent ea24cf92557a5a30c4d8d8f8555ad57003afb02a templater: tell hggettext to collect help of template functions diff -r ea24cf92557a -r d80819f67d59 Makefile --- a/Makefile Tue Mar 10 09:57:42 2015 -0700 +++ b/Makefile Fri Apr 03 21:36:39 2015 +0900 @@ -118,6 +118,7 @@ hgext/*.py hgext/*/__init__.py \ mercurial/fileset.py mercurial/revset.py \ mercurial/templatefilters.py mercurial/templatekw.py \ + mercurial/templater.py \ mercurial/filemerge.py \ $(DOCFILES) > i18n/hg.pot.tmp # All strings marked for translation in Mercurial contain diff -r ea24cf92557a -r d80819f67d59 mercurial/templater.py --- a/mercurial/templater.py Tue Mar 10 09:57:42 2015 -0700 +++ b/mercurial/templater.py Fri Apr 03 21:36:39 2015 +0900 @@ -793,3 +793,6 @@ return style, mapfile raise RuntimeError("No hgweb templates found in %r" % paths) + +# tell hggettext to extract docstrings from these functions: +i18nfunctions = funcs.values()